NexCen names Lane new chief accounting officer

October 8, 2009

NexCen Brands Inc. has announced the appointment of Brian D. Lane as vice president, chief accounting officer. He will report to Mark Stanko, chief financial officer. Lane, 47, will be responsible for overseeing the company's SEC reporting and corporate accounting functions as well as managing its accounting policies and procedures.
 
Lane has 25 years of experience in finance and accounting. He served for seven years as CFO of Blimpie International Inc. Most recently, he served as chief accounting officer of Altisource Portfolio Solutions, a newly public company for which Lane was instrumental in completing its spin-off from Ocwen Financial Corporation. Lane is a certified public accountant and holds a bachelor's degree in accounting from the University of Georgia.
 
NexCen's portfolio of franchise brands includes two retail franchise conceptsands five quick-service restaurant franchise concepts: Great American Cookies, MaggieMoo's, Marble Slab Creamery, Pretzelmaker and Pretzel Time. The brands are managed by NexCen Franchise Management Inc., a subsidiary of NexCen Brands.
 
In unrelated news, the company has filed its 2008 Annual Report on Form 10-K and Quarterly Report on Form 10-Q for the periods ending Dec. 31, 2008, and March 31, 2009, respectively, with the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C). The financial statements for these periods contain no material changes from the selected results previously announced on Sept. 22, 2009.
